What is 5G and Why is it Revolutionary?

At its core, 5G builds on the foundations laid by earlier generations, offering faster speeds, lower latency, and the capacity to connect a vast number of devices simultaneously. While 4G brought us streaming, mobile apps, and social media as we know them today, 5G is poised to take connectivity to a whole new level.

With speeds up to 100 times faster than 4G, 5G networks can download high-definition movies in seconds and enable real-time communication with minimal lag. Its ultra-low latency—measured in milliseconds—makes it ideal for applications where delays are critical, such as autonomous vehicles, remote surgery, and augmented reality (AR).


Transforming Industries

The impact of 5G extends beyond consumer convenience; it has the potential to transform industries and reshape global economies.

1. Healthcare:

Imagine a world where surgeons in New York can perform intricate surgeries on patients in Tokyo using robotic arms and real-time video feeds. 5G makes this possible with its low latency and reliable connectivity. Additionally, wearable devices connected via 5G can monitor patients’ health in real-time, allowing for early detection of diseases and personalized treatments.

2. Transportation and Mobility:

Autonomous vehicles rely heavily on real-time data to navigate safely. With 5G, vehicles can communicate with each other and with infrastructure, such as traffic lights and road sensors, to optimize routes and avoid collisions. This technology not only enhances safety but also reduces traffic congestion and lowers emissions.


3. Manufacturing:

The advent of smart factories powered by 5G is revolutionizing manufacturing. Real-time monitoring of machinery, predictive maintenance, and the use of collaborative robots (cobots) improve efficiency and reduce downtime. 5G-enabled networks also facilitate seamless communication between devices in the Industrial Internet of Things (IIoT).

4. Entertainment and Gaming:

The gaming industry is already experiencing the benefits of 5G with cloud gaming platforms, where players can stream high-quality games without expensive hardware. Virtual reality (VR) and augmented reality (AR) experiences are becoming more immersive, creating new possibilities for entertainment, education, and training.


5. Agriculture:

In agriculture, 5G enables precision farming, where sensors and drones collect data on soil quality, crop health, and weather conditions. Farmers can use this data to make informed decisions, improving yields and reducing waste.

The Internet of Things (IoT) Explosion

One of the most exciting aspects of 5G is its ability to support the Internet of Things (IoT). By connecting billions of devices, from smart home appliances to industrial sensors, 5G creates a network where everything communicates seamlessly. This connectivity allows for smarter cities, where traffic systems, utilities, and emergency services work in harmony, improving the quality of life for residents.


Challenges and Considerations

Despite its potential, the rollout of 5G comes with challenges. The infrastructure required for 5G, including small cell towers, is costly and time-intensive to deploy. Additionally, concerns about cybersecurity and data privacy are magnified as more devices become interconnected. Ensuring that 5G networks are secure from cyber threats is paramount.

Another concern is the digital divide. While urban areas are quick to adopt 5G, rural and underserved regions risk being left behind, exacerbating existing inequalities in access to technology. Policymakers and service providers must address this gap to ensure equitable access to 5G’s benefits.
